Indian Overseas Bank RD Interest Rates 2026 – Check IOB Recurring Deposit Rates

Planning to save money every month with guaranteed returns? The Indian Overseas Bank (IOB) Recurring Deposit (RD) is a reliable option for disciplined monthly savings, with no market risk.

In this 2026 guide, we’ll cover the latest IOB RD interest rates, features, tenure options, maturity calculation example, eligibility, and tax rules — explained step-by-step.

Quick Summary: IOB RD 2026

FeatureDetails
Interest Rate (2026)Around 6.25% – 7.25% p.a.*
Senior Citizen RateUsually 0.50% higher
Minimum Monthly Deposit₹100 (may vary by branch)
Tenure6 months to 10 years
CompoundingQuarterly
Premature ClosureAllowed with a penalty
Loan Against RDAvailable
Risk LevelLow

*Interest rates may vary depending on tenure and bank revisions. Check the IOB branch or the internet banking for the latest confirmation.

Latest Indian Overseas Bank RD Interest Rates 2026

IOB RD rates are generally linked to its Fixed Deposit (FD) rates for similar tenures.

Typical Interest Rate Range (2026):

  • General Public: 6.25% – 7.25% per annum
  • Senior Citizens: Up to 0.50% higher

The rate applicable at the time of opening remains fixed for the entire RD tenure.

Interest is compounded quarterly and paid at maturity.

IOB RD Interest Calculation Example (2026)

Let’s assume:

  • ₹2,500 deposited monthly
  • Tenure: 5 years
  • Interest Rate: 7%

Total Investment: ₹1,50,000
Estimated Maturity Amount: Around ₹1,76,000+

(Exact maturity value depends on applicable rate and compounding. Use the IOB RD calculator for precise figures.)

Key Features of IOB RD

Affordable Monthly Deposit

  • Minimum deposit starts at ₹100.
  • Deposits are usually in multiples of ₹100.

Auto-Debit Facility

  • The monthly installment can be automatically debited from the IOB savings account.
  • Helps avoid missed payments.

Loan Against RD

  • Loan facility available (usually up to 75–90% of RD balance).
  • Interest slightly higher than the RD rate.

Premature Closure Allowed

  • RD can be closed before maturity.
  • Penalty charges apply.
  • Interest paid as per bank norms.

Nomination Facility

  • Nominee can be added at the time of opening.
  • Can update nominee later if required.

Eligibility Criteria

You can open an IOB RD if you are:

  • Resident Indian individual
  • Minor (with guardian)
  • Joint account holder
  • HUF (as per bank rules)

NRIs may be eligible under NRE/NRO RD schemes (check the branch for confirmation).

How to Open an IOB RD (Step-by-Step)

Through Internet Banking

  1. Log in to IOB Internet Banking
  2. Go to “Deposits”
  3. Select “Recurring Deposit”
  4. Enter monthly amount & tenure
  5. Confirm details

Through the Mobile Banking App

  1. Open the IOB Mobile Banking app
  2. Select the Deposit option
  3. Choose Recurring Deposit
  4. Enter the amount and tenure
  5. Confirm transaction

Through Branch

  1. Visit the nearest IOB branch
  2. Fill the RD application form
  3. Submit KYC documents (if required)
  4. Deposit the first installment

Is IOB RD Interest Taxable?

Yes.

  • Interest earned is fully taxable.
  • TDS applies if the total interest exceeds the prescribed limit.
  • Submit Form 15G/15H if eligible.
  • Declare RD interest in your ITR.

RD does not provide a tax benefit under Section 80C.
